Direct mercury analysis eliminates sample preparation, it is matrix independent, and it provides analysis within a few minutes.This report studies a compact direct mercury analyzer.

Major global manufacturers of Compact Direct Mercury Analyzer include Milestone, Teledyne Leeman Labs, Metrohm, Nippon Instruments, Lumex Instruments, Hitachi Hightech, Perkin Elmer, etc. In 2025, the world's top three vendors accounted for approximately % of revenue.
